Persevere and expectation


As 2010 began the Lord gave me the word acceleration and promised that I could break free from the fear of man.  True always to His Word the year moved with ever increasing speed and as it drew to a close that acceleration seemed to thrust me into 2011.  I found myself again seeking Him for His hand and heart of direction, journal at the ready to record what He would share:

Lord God, I am looking to You for a guiding word and scripture for the year ahead.  Rick's word of blessing last night was persevere and I submit that word back to You.

So do not throw away your confidence; it will be richly rewarded. You need to persevere so that when you have done the will of God, you will receive what he has promised. For, “In just a little while, he who is coming will come and will not delay.” And, “But my righteous one will live by faith. And I take no pleasure in the one who shrinks back.”  But we do not belong to those who shrink back and are destroyed, but to those who have faith and are saved. Hebrews 10:35-39 NIV

Blessed is the one who perseveres under trial because, having stood the test, that person will receive the crown of life that the Lord has promised to those who love him.  James 1:12 NIV


Therefore, since we are surrounded by such a great cloud of witnesses, let us throw off everything that hinders and the sin that so easily entangles. And let us run with perseverance the race marked out for us Hebrews 12:1 NIV
 
Continue to search My Word for more -
Persevere in faith
Persevere in trust
Persevere in hope
Know that I Am with you
 
As you stand, as you persevere, and yes, as you wait, little one, let this also be a year of expectation.
 
This is the time to hope in My glory.  This is the time to expect not only the best of Me but the best from yourself - for as you have surrendered and submitted that "self" to Me it is indeed My life and My power alive in you.
 
Surely I have said even greater things will you do than I have done while I walked the earth.
 
Only believe, My child, that you are loved, chosen to be light, an agent of change in the darkness.
 
Expect my love.  Expect My grace.  Expect My will to prevail.

And so, with the power of Christ alive in me, I will stand, I will wait, I will persevere and walk through the year ahead of me with great expectation of His glory revealed.
